"I watched Negroni resurface in April inside the former Mírame space on Canon Drive in Beverly Hills after closing on West Third Street; the new location is noticeably brighter, airier, and less gothic than the previous nearly all-black space. The menu is mostly the same but smartly reduced to core dishes—cheeseburgers, pasta, risotto Milanese, beef carpaccio with shaved black truffle, and sushi rolls—that pair with a wide Negroni cocktail menu, and the drinks play well in the swanky lounge interiors and patio. Negroni is open daily from noon to 10 p.m." - Matthew Kang
